The beaches and views from the top of Hoekwil or Map of...
The beaches and views from the top of Hoekwil or Map of Africa are too beautiful. The nature walks and general magical feeling of the place makes it an ideal holiday destination. It is close to the large town of George and Knysna with markets available on Saturdays,
You would need a car to get around Wilderness.

We stayed three nights in Wilderness and that was probably...
We stayed three nights in Wilderness and that was probably the perfect length of stay. It's a small town, but a very beautiful location. The long beach is nice, if you like that sort of thing.However, exploring the lagoon on an 'eco-cruise' is a 'must' and probably the most enjoyable adventure on our three-week stay in South Africa. Wilderness is also blessed with some good restaurants, 'The Girls On The Square' deserves an accolade, but 'Serendipity' is in a league of its own - one of the best restaurants I've visited anywhere in the world.
